When you set VLC to 100%, the software is playing the audio file at its native amplitude—the maximum level it was recorded at without modification. vlc media player volume 400

In older versions of VLC (specifically version 2.1.0 and earlier), the default volume slider allowed users to scroll up to 400%. This feature was incredibly popular for laptops with weak built-in speakers or for video files with poorly mixed, quiet audio tracks.
